What is accounting software coding?

Accounting software coding involves designing, developing, and maintaining computer programs that help businesses manage their financial transactions and records. This can include building features for invoicing, payroll, expense tracking, and reporting based on accounting principles. Professionals in this field need a strong understanding of both software development and accounting practices to ensure accuracy and compliance. These specialists often work with programming languages like Python, Java, or C#, and may integrate their solutions with other business systems.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in accounting software coding?

To thrive in Accounting Software Coding, you need strong programming skills (often in languages like Java, C#, or Python), a solid understanding of accounting principles, and a relevant degree in computer science or accounting. Experience with ERP systems, accounting software platforms (like QuickBooks or SAP), and familiarity with databases and APIs are typically required.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ication are valuable soft skills for collaborating with stakeholders and troubleshooting complex issues. These skills and qualities are crucial to building reliable, compliant, and user-friendly accounting solutions that meet business needs.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als coding for accounting software,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als coding for accounting software often encounter challenges such as ensuring compliance with evolving financial regulations, handling complex data integrations, and maintaining data security. It’s crucial to stay up-to-date with accounting standards and work closely with domain experts to design accurate financial modules. Additionally, collaborating with QA teams to rigorously test features helps catch errors early, and following secure coding practices minimizes risks related to sensitive financial data.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Prepares and deposits cash and checks from the various sites daily, including regular trips to the bank to deposit cash or cash checks.
  • Tracks and updates the daily cash flow report. Reconciles cash received from sites with billing system.
  • Codes and records cash and check deposits into Accounting system daily.
  • Codes and records credit card receipts into Accounting system.
  • Reviews, codes and enters employee expense reimbursements in Accounting system.
  • Manages petty cash system, ensuring the account is reconciled monthly and replenished in a timely manner to assure availability of cash as needed.
  • Maintains a filing system for all bank and investment accounts.
  • Maintains a filing system for all cash, checks and credit card deposits and transactions.
  • Assembles financial data for audits. Assists the accounting team with other month end reporting documentations as needed, such as bank statements, deposit records, grant payment check copies, etc.
